A few of director John Landis’ best offerings are onscreen this week at BAM. This week, An American Werewolf in London lets you in on how they used to make werewolf movies, when Taylor Lautner was just a twinkle in someone’s eye. That is to say, there is definitely an equal sense of ridiculousness in this tale of two American hikers who get bit in the countryside and return to London to find themselves a lot hairier than they remember. It’s full of over-the-top acting, terrible special effects, and roaring. Not that much different than Twilight, actually.

Following the werewolf movie is Coming Soon, a compilation of cheesy movie trailers that Landis put together himself. Rare treats, both, as Werewolf will be show in 35mm and Coming Soon on VHS.
